I was somewhat surprised by how much I enjoyed this DVD. It's an all-cardio dance workout which is accompanied by various styles of dance music, much of it having a jazz, broadway, funk or disco flare interwoven into a modern techno/electronica sound. The all-female exercisers are dressed in varying colorful, cute outfits and the instructor, Gypsy Clark, is perfectly fitting for this workout with her peppy, upbeat personality. What I especially enjoyed about this video is that many of the dance moves were relatively new to me and seemed fluid, fresh and feminine, which is a nice change of pace from the standard cha chas and mambos I'm used to. Although this is mostly lower impact, it will elevate your heart rate (although it won't leave you dripping in sweat), especially once you've mastered the moves enough to really throw yourself into them to increase the intensity. Overall this is a fun, girly workout suitable for beginners, on lighter intensity days, or for anyone who likes dance workouts and is looking for something new and exciting to try!

Crunch Cardio Go-Go Dance runs approximately 41 minutes with warmup and cooldown. Instructor Gypsy Clark does a reasonably good job with cueing. Very personable instructor, although I didn't need to hear how "hot" I was every few minutes!

There's some impact in this one but I found it easy to modify. I didn't have any issues with doing this one on carpet.

There's some Go-Go type dancing in this workout, but there's also some fun 50's burlesque style dancing (think Gypsy Rose Lee) which I had fun doing. Unfortunately, I couldn't really get the heartrate up there, but I can't elevate my heartrate with my Island Girl hula workouts either...this is just some fun dancing stuff.

The music was adequate...however, there's one section in the workout where the music didn't match the movement. I'm guessing that Crunch couldn't get the license to the music piece they wanted and subbed another music piece in, which was a tiny bit slower tempo than what the dancers were using. I recognized it from Crunch Cardio Salsa...it didn't really work for the dance moves in the section. It was a little off-putting seeing the dancers one beat ahead of myself...Crunch REALLY should have fixed the music in that section before releasing the DVD. But it's just 5 minutes out of the 41 minutes of workout, so I'll survive.

Recommend to intermediates with some dance experience.

This video was okay, and this is coming from someone who loves dance based workout DVDs. It was a lot of bouncing around instead of true dancing. The instructor is easy to follow and her directions are clear enough, but I found her dancers to be a bit on the annoying side. I also didn't get what was so "go-go" dance about it. It jumped from jazz to hip hop to latin...didn't flow well. However, like another reviewer mentioned, the movements are sexy and feminine. I would say a person who has 2 left feet wouldn't enjoy this video too much.

It does give you a low-impact aerobic workout, but I don't think you'd magically lose 20 pounds doing this video, you'd need a more challenging video. Regardless, I worked up a sweat but I found myself a bit bored and wondering how much longer I had until the workout was over. A bit too cheesy and silly for my taste. Richard Simmons DVD's it is!
